This 3D pie chart highlights the distribution of roles in the industry, featuring: 1. **Energy Policy Analyst** (35%): Professionals in this role assess the effectiveness and impact of energy policies, regulations, and programs. They identify trends, analyze data, and develop recommendations to optimize policy outcomes. 2. **Energy Economist** (25%): Energy economists study the production, distribution, and consumption of energy resources from an economic perspective. They analyze market data, develop forecasts, and create economic models to inform decision-making within the energy sector. 3. **Renewable Energy Specialist** (20%): These professionals focus on the planning, development, and implementation of renewable energy projects and technologies. They evaluate renewable energy resources, assess project feasibility, and collaborate with stakeholders to promote clean energy solutions. 4. **Energy Efficiency Expert** (15%): Energy efficiency experts identify opportunities to reduce energy consumption and costs in various sectors, such as buildings, transportation, and manufacturing. They analyze energy usage patterns, recommend efficiency measures, and help organizations implement energy-saving strategies. 5. **Sustainability Consultant** (5%): Sustainability consultants work with businesses, governments, and non-profit organizations to develop and implement sustainable practices. They assess environmental impact, recommend eco-friendly solutions, and help organizations integrate sustainability into their operations and culture.
